Au café-restaurant 
Write a role-play taking place in a café in France. Have a minimum of 3 characters plus a waiter/waitress. Each customer must order a minimum of 2 dishes and 1 drink. There must be at least 1 unusual exchange with the waiter/waitress (eg: item missing on menu, issue with check, etc.). There must be a money conversation in the role play.

Content (30%)

Your ability to follow the instructions and complete all tasks required.

7 - Excellent performance

Always understands and responds clearly and effectively to information and ideas within the full range of prescribed topics.
6 - Very good performance

Nearly always understands and responds clearly to information and ideas within the range of
prescribed topics.
5 - Good performance

Generally understands and responds clearly to information and ideas within the range of prescribed
topics.
4 - Satisfactory performance

Understands and responds clearly to some information and ideas within the range of prescribed topics.
3 - Mediocre performance

Occasionally understands and responds clearly to information within the range of prescribed topics.
2 - Poor performance

Seldom understands or responds clearly to information within the range of prescribed topics.
1 - Very poor performance

Never understands or responds clearly to information within the range of prescribed topics.
Language (30%)

The level and quality of the language you use, correct register, level and clarity of communication

7 - Excellent performance

Consistently displays a high level of accuracy and fluency in the use of both
simple and more complex structures.
6 - Very good performance

Communicates with some ease and fluency, using both simple and more complex structures accurately for the most part.
5 - Good performance

Uses simple language accurately for the most part, with some attempt at more complex
structures.
4 - Satisfactory performance

Uses simple structures fairly accurately with no attempt at more complex language use.
3 - Mediocre performance

Occasionally communicates at a basic level though with many errors.
2 - Poor performance

Displays a very limited grasp of basic language. Errors frequently impair communication.
1 - Very poor performance

Displays almost total inaccuracy in use of language. Errors impede communication.
Grammar/Vocabulary (30%)

Range and accuracy of vocabulary and grammar.

7 - Excellent performance

Demonstrates a wide range and variety of vocabulary and
structures.
6 - Very good performance

Demonstrates a wide range of vocabulary and structures.
5 - Good performance

Demonstrates an appropriate range of vocabulary and structures.
4 - Satisfactory performance

Demonstrates a rather limited, but adequate range of vocabulary and structures.
3 - Mediocre performance

Demonstrates a limited, barely
adequate range of vocabulary and structures.
2 - Poor performance

Demonstrates minimal, frequently inadequate vocabulary and structures.
1 - Very poor performance

Demonstrates repetitive and mostly inadequate vocabulary and structures.
Presentation/Effort (10%)

Does your work show basic research/content, etc. or did you go the extra mile?

7 - Excellent performance

Work is above standards in all ways: excellent research and creativity, shows originality and use of more complex language and grammar structures.
6 - Very good performance

Work is above standards, shows extra research and creativity leading to opportunities to show student's extra knowledge of the language.
5 - Good performance

Work goes beyond the minimum requirements and shows some extra research/creativity.
4 - Satisfactory performance

Work meets all the minimum requirements and standards expected but shows no extra research or creativity.
3 - Mediocre performance

Most requirements are met but general performance is poor.
2 - Poor performance

Part of the requirements are met but attempt is poor and below standard.
1 - Very poor performance

Work is of an unacceptable standard.
